GENERAL FOODS CORPORATION v. THE TROUBADOR


98 F.Supp. 207 (1951)

GENERAL FOODS CORPORATION et al. v. THE TROUBADOR et al. GREAT ATLANTIC & PACIFIC TEA CO. et al. v. THE TROUBADOR et al.

United States District Court S. D. New York.

March 21, 1951.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Hill, Rivkins & Middleton, New York City, Proctors for Libelants, by A. O. Louis, New York City, M. F. Walsh, Brooklyn, N. Y., advocates.

Irving H. Saypol, U. S. Atty., New York City, Proctor for United States of America (War Shipping Administration) Cosmopolitan Shipping Co., Inc., and Moore-McCormack, Lines by Horace M. Gray, New York City, advocate.

Burlingham, Veeder, Clark & Hupper, New York City, Proctors for United Fruit Company, by H. M. Lord, R. A. Feltner, New York City, advocates.


GODDARD, District Judge.

These consolidated suits seek to recover for loss and damage to shipments of bagged coffee from Santos, Brazil, to New York City in the S. S. Troubador, a vessel that was owned, operated, managed and controlled during the voyage involved in this action by the respondent United States.
